Kinds of Welder’s Qualifications

Although the American Welding Society’s standard CW (Certified Welder) certificate opens the door for the majority of positions, many fields require their certain certificate. Examples of the most-widely used of these appear below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for welders who work with boiler and pressurized containers
  • CW Credentials to be a Certified Welder
  • API Certification for individuals that deal with pipelines in the gas and oil industry
  • CWI and SCWI Certificates for inspectors and senior inspectors

This table illustrates employment and salary forecasts for professional welders in the State of California through the end of the decade.

California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 24,700 26,300 7% 770
California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$23,900 $38,600 $65,600

Source: O*Net Online
